10 Tony Romo ($70 Million)

Since we talked about athletes in the introduction of our article, we might as well start with a former athlete. At 39 years old, Tony Romo is still young enough to be playing football. Nevertheless, the Dallas Cowboys got tired of him in 2017 and put their chips in Dak Prescott. Romo then decided that playing football was not something he wanted to do anymore.

So Romo took his talents to the television screen, and it has been one hell of a ride for him. He became one of the most popular sportscasters in America and is looking to become one of the highest paid pundits in the world, as he is seeking a $10 million yearly salary from CBS. Meanwhile, he is getting paid $4 million a year.

9 Max Kellerman ($6 Million)

Arguably one of the best boxing analysts of our time, Max Kellerman has expanded his role in the sports community and is now a voice to be heard across a variety of different sports. The reason for that is he is now a co-host of ESPN’s fan-favorite show, First Take. Before making it big on ESPN, Kellerman was already a fan-favorite, working ringside for HBO when they had boxing in their programming.

At 45 years old, Kellerman is still rising in the industry, as is his salary, which is reported at around $3 million to $5 million. His net worth is also on the rise, as he is currently worth somewhere around $6 million.

8 Al Michaels ($20 Million)

After talking about a couple of the younger guys in the game, it's time to go to a sportscasting legend. We are obviously talking about Al Michaels. At 74 years old, Michaels is still one of the biggest names in sportscasting. Covering everything from the Olympics, to boxing, and numerous Super Bowls, Michaels is as versatile as they get in the industry, and that has earned him a lot of money.

The Brooklyn native makes around $6 million a year in his contract with NBC Sports and has a net worth of around $20 million. He has earned several awards during his career, including five Emmy Awards for outstanding sports personality.

5 Dan Patrick ($25 Million)

Another member of the old guard, 63-year-old Dan Patrick has been in the game since he started working for a local TV station in Dayton, Ohio in 1979. From there, he worked for CNN, ESPN, ABC, Sports Illustrated, NBC, and now he is at Bleacher Report. An all-around talent, Patrick is mostly known for his work with football, as he has covered the sport for as long as most people can remember. Still, he can talk about basketball, the Olympics, or probably any other sport you can name.

4 Bob Costas ($45 Million)

The higher we go on this list, the bigger the guns get. Now, we have 67-year-old Bob Costas, who is currently working for the MLB Network and makes around $7 million a year. One of the things most of these guys have in common is that they are versatile and they understand sports as a whole, despite most of them having a particular niche where they are exceptional.

Costas is no different, as he has covered virtually everything during his tenure with NBC Sports, from boxing to golf, baseball, NASCAR, basketball, football, hockey, the Olympics, and even thoroughbred racing. Yes, the man has covered everything, and it is no surprise he has a net worth of around $45 million.

1 Jim Rome ($75 Million)

Years come and years go, and the one thing we can all be sure of is that Jim Rome is still going to be the highest paid sportscaster in America. The man has had the most popular sports show in the country for so long that it is not surprising at all that he gets paid a ridiculous $30 million a year in annual salary from his various TV and radio shows.

Yes, while the other guys on this list are making $5 million or $6 million, this man is pulling in $30 million. It almost doesn’t seem fair, but when you have cultivated as large an audience as Rome has over the years, you get to reap the fruits of your success.
